How We Help You Enter India
Regulatory Landscape Assessment
We analyse your product portfolio and identify every regulatory body, license, certification, and approval required for legal market entry in India.
Pathway Design & Timeline
A detailed regulatory roadmap with timelines, documentation checklists, cost estimates, and a prioritised sequence of filings for the fastest path to market.
Documentation & Filing
Our team prepares all regulatory dossiers, technical files, and application forms — ensuring every submission meets the exact requirements of each authority.
Authority Liaison
We manage all communication with regulatory bodies including CDSCO, FSSAI, BIS, DGFT, and others — handling queries, site inspections, and follow-ups.
Market Authorization
From initial filing to final approval, we track every application through the system and ensure timely issuance of all licenses and certificates.
Post-Market Compliance
Once you're in the market, we provide ongoing vigilance, renewal management, and compliance monitoring to keep your products authorized.
